探索证书透明度日志搜索:保护网络安全的利器
探索证书透明度日志搜索:保护网络安全的利器
在当今数字化时代,网络安全成为了每个互联网用户和企业的首要关注点。证书透明度日志搜索(Certificate Transparency Log Search)作为一种新兴的技术,正在逐渐成为保护网络安全的重要工具。本文将为大家详细介绍证书透明度日志搜索的概念、工作原理、应用场景以及其在网络安全中的重要性。
什么是证书透明度日志搜索?
证书透明度(Certificate Transparency, CT)是一种公开记录和监控SSL/TLS证书发放的系统。它的核心思想是通过公开透明的日志记录来确保所有发放的证书都是可见的,从而防止未经授权的证书发放和中间人攻击。证书透明度日志搜索则是指通过搜索这些公开的日志来查找和验证特定域名的证书信息。
工作原理
当一个证书被颁发时,它会被提交到一个或多个CT日志服务器。这些服务器会记录证书的详细信息,包括证书的序列号、签发者、有效期等。任何人都可以通过证书透明度日志搜索工具查询这些日志,查看某个域名是否有相关的证书记录,以及这些证书是否有效。
应用场景
-
安全监控:企业和安全研究人员可以使用证书透明度日志搜索来监控其域名是否被未授权的证书签发,从而及时发现潜在的安全威胁。
-
证书管理:网站管理员可以利用CT日志来管理和更新其SSL/TLS证书,确保证书的有效性和安全性。
-
漏洞检测:通过分析CT日志,可以发现证书的配置错误或潜在的漏洞,如过期证书、弱加密算法等。
-
法律合规:一些行业标准和法律法规要求企业必须使用CT日志来确保其证书的透明度和可追溯性。
相关工具和服务
- Google CT Search:Google提供的CT日志搜索工具,允许用户查询特定域名的证书信息。
- Censys:一个网络搜索引擎,提供CT日志搜索功能,帮助用户发现和分析网络中的证书。
- CertSpotter:由SSL Labs提供的服务,监控域名的证书变更并提供实时通知。
- CTFE(Certificate Transparency for Everyone):一个开源的CT日志服务器,允许任何人运行自己的CT日志。
证书透明度日志搜索的优势
- 增强安全性:通过公开透明的证书记录,减少了伪造证书的可能性。
- 提高透明度:任何人都可以验证证书的真实性,增强了互联网的信任度。
- 快速响应:一旦发现异常证书,可以迅速采取措施,减少潜在的安全风险。
- 法律和合规性:符合许多国家和行业的安全标准和法规要求。
注意事项
虽然证书透明度日志搜索提供了许多好处,但也需要注意一些潜在的问题:
- 隐私问题:公开的证书信息可能会泄露某些敏感信息。
- 性能影响:大量的证书查询可能会对日志服务器造成性能压力。
- 误报:有时可能会出现误报,需要人工验证。
结论
证书透明度日志搜索作为网络安全的一个重要组成部分,正在被越来越多的企业和个人所采用。它不仅提高了网络的安全性和透明度,还为安全研究和管理提供了有力的工具。在未来,随着互联网安全需求的不断提升,证书透明度日志搜索的应用将会更加广泛,帮助我们构建一个更加安全、可信的网络环境。